1. SOP: Operational Planning
Purpose: This SOP outlines the process for developing operational plans to achieve military objectives. It includes the identification of mission requirements, analysis of the operational environment, and the development of courses of action. The purpose is to ensure effective planning and coordination of military operations.
Scope: This SOP applies to all military units and personnel involved in operational planning.
Person Responsible: The Major General, as the senior military officer, is responsible for overseeing the operational planning process and ensuring its adherence.
References: This SOP may reference other related SOPs such as Intelligence Preparation of the Battlefield (IPB) SOP, Logistics Planning SOP, and Communications Planning SOP.
2. SOP: Command and Control
Purpose: This SOP establishes guidelines for the command and control of military forces during operations. It outlines the responsibilities and authorities of commanders, the flow of information, and the decision-making process. The purpose is to ensure effective leadership and coordination of military units.
Scope: This SOP applies to all military units and personnel involved in command and control activities.
Person Responsible: The Major General, as the commanding officer, is responsible for implementing and overseeing the command and control process.
References: This SOP may reference other related SOPs such as Tactical Operations Center (TOC) SOP, Communications SOP, and Battle Rhythm SOP.

4. SOP: Risk Management
Purpose: This SOP outlines the process for identifying, assessing, and mitigating risks associated with military operations. It includes the identification of hazards, evaluation of risks, and the implementation of control measures. The purpose is to minimize the potential for accidents, injuries, and mission failures.
Scope: This SOP applies to all military units and personnel involved in operational activities.
Person Responsible: The Major General, in collaboration with the Safety Officer, is responsible for implementing and overseeing the risk management process.
References: This SOP may reference other related SOPs such as Safety SOP, Emergency Response SOP, and Training SOP.
5. SOP: After-Action Review (AAR)
Purpose: This SOP establishes guidelines for conducting after-action reviews to evaluate the effectiveness of military operations. It includes the collection of feedback, analysis of performance, and the identification of lessons learned. The purpose is to improve future operations and enhance organizational learning.
Scope: This SOP applies to all military units and personnel involved in operational activities.
Person Responsible: The Major General, in coordination with the Operations Officer, is responsible for conducting and overseeing after-action reviews.
References: This SOP may reference other related SOPs such as Lessons Learned SOP, Training Improvement SOP, and Documentation SOP
